The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Northwestern Mutual (Latham, NY) in Mar 2010
Interview
I met with the Recruiter a presentation at my college and e-mailed later that night attached with my resume. After the first interview they had led me to believe that I would be sponsored for my Series 7 and 66 licensing and that I would have a more dynamic internship meeting with prospective clients. After the second interview they assigned me to create a natural market before I accept the internship consisting of 100 name of people in my market and 10 market surveys within that market.
